CVE-2021-44023 is a link following denial-of-service (DoS) vulnerability affecting Trend Micro Security (Consumer) 2021 products. An attacker can exploit the PC Health Checkup feature to create symbolic links, leading to unauthorized file modification and a denial-of-service condition. With a CVSS score of 7.1 (High), this vulnerability has a low attack complexity and requires local privileges, but can result in high integrity and availability impacts. There is currently no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ion or media coverage.
